Output 74f0d8ef83a87967dac3df235cdd4700c04c591884c4bea22d24a77fd8637974:7

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5816a9704e99c7a59498c98076668267e399e64f OP_EQUAL
address
39inXzuR9ssunciDpkzzBkDDJW1gUfuP2e
transaction
74f0d8ef83a87967dac3df235cdd4700c04c591884c4bea22d24a77fd8637974
spent
true